White papersTSIA 2015 Remote Support Trends
As of 2015 remote support solutions are typically well regarded by users, consistently delivering one of the highest average satisfaction scores in TSIA’s annual Global Technology Survey. Service executives should acquaint themselves with the new features and capabilities being introduced by leading remote support platforms and find ways to leverage the capabilities beyond technical support. Field services, education services, professional services, and managed services are all increasing adoption of these tools to boost productivity and avoid on-site visits.

White papersGartner Network Design Best Practices for Office 365
“Many organizations transitioning from on-premises Microsoft applications to Office 365 will experience performance problems due to geographic factors and use of the Internet for connectivity. IT can minimize performance issues and deliver an acceptable experience to end users by paying careful attention to network design.

White papersHow Blockchain Is Illuminating the Supply Chain Like Never Before
By using blockchain within a B2B network, events representing the exchange of documents could be recorded on a shared ledger – along with new kinds of supplemental events, including those produced by third-party IoT and smart devices. This can and likely will be accomplished by building upon, rather than replacing, technologies and systems that are used today. We envision blockchain, that is, providing a shared visibility overlay.
